What type of brake is best for an e-bike motor?

Hydraulic disc brakes are generally the best choice for e-bikes because they offer strong, consistent stopping power with good modulation. Look for 4-piston calipers for heavier e-bikes. Mechanical disc brakes are a simpler, cheaper alternative but provide less power and require more adjustment.

Can I use regenerative braking alone without friction brakes?

Regenerative braking can slow the motor and recover energy, but it is not sufficient as a primary brake in most vehicles. It often lacks the stopping power at low speeds and in emergencies. Friction brakes (disc or drum) are still needed for safe, reliable stopping.

How do I choose the right rotor size for my electric motor brake?

Rotor size affects braking torque and heat dissipation. Larger rotors provide more leverage and better heat management but add weight. For e-bikes, 180mm to 203mm rotors are common. Heavier riders or faster speeds benefit from larger rotors. Always check frame and fork clearance.

Are mineral oil or DOT fluid brakes better for electric motors?

Both work well, but mineral oil is less corrosive and easier to maintain for most users. DOT fluid has a higher boiling point and is more widely available, but it can damage paint and requires careful handling. The choice often comes down to brand preference and system compatibility.

Do I need a brake that is compatible with motor cut-off switches?

Yes, for e-bikes and many electric vehicles, the brake lever should have a switch that cuts power to the motor when the brake is applied. This prevents the motor from fighting the brake and is a safety requirement in many regions. Most hydraulic brake levers have optional switch sensors.
